"Where an adjournment of the appeal is requested, the appellate authority shall not adjourn the hearing unless it is satisfied that refusing the adjournment would prevent the just disposal of the appeal"
"I refused the adjournment as firstly this matter had been outstanding for some considerable time, the decision appealed against being given in February 2002 but more importantly the matters contained within that application were already canvassed by the appellant in his evidence. What weight I gave to such matters was to be considered in the round at the end of the hearing but I noted that both the appellant and his wife were present, it was stated that they could speak both Polish and English fluently."
"In actual fact both the appellant and his wife made it crystal clear that in fact they were vehemently opposed to any adjournment and wished the matter determined that day. The matter was then adjourned over lunch to enable them to speak to their Counsel if he was so minded as to advise them as to any procedure to follow."

"The claimant's counsel withdrew before the Adjudicator. The Adjudicator offered the claimant, who is an educated man, an adjournment. He declined the offer. Thereafter the proceedings seem to me to have been conducted fairly and applying the correct legal principles to the questions that arose. I can accordingly see nothing in grounds 1 to 5 that could found an appeal. "
